在MySQL中,模糊查询通常使用LIKE关键字和通配符来实现,非例外字段是指在进行模糊查询时,不需要考虑的字段,为了详细解释这个概念,我们可以从以下几个方面来展开:
1、模糊查询简介
2、LIKE关键字和通配符
3、非例外字段的概念
4、示例
1、模糊查询简介
模糊查询是数据库查询的一种类型,它允许用户根据某个字段的部分内容来查找数据,在实际应用中,模糊查询可以帮助用户快速找到满足特定条件的数据。
2、LIKE关键字和通配符
在MySQL中,模糊查询主要通过LIKE关键字和通配符来实现,LIKE关键字用于指定一个模式,而通配符则是用于表示任意字符的特殊符号,常用的通配符有以下两种:
%:表示任意数量的字符(包括0个)
_:表示一个任意字符
3、非例外字段的概念
在进行模糊查询时,我们可能会遇到一些不需要进行模糊匹配的字段,这些字段就是所谓的非例外字段,假设我们有一个用户表,包含以下字段:id、name、age、email,在进行模糊查询时,我们可能只需要对name和email字段进行模糊匹配,而不需要对id和age字段进行模糊匹配,这时,id和age字段就是非例外字段。
4、示例
假设我们有一个用户表(user),包含以下字段:id、name、age、email,现在我们想要查找名字或邮箱中包含"张"的用户,可以使用以下SQL语句:
SELECT * FROM user WHERE name LIKE '%张%' OR email LIKE '%张%';
在这个例子中,id和age字段是非例外字段,因为它们没有被包含在模糊查询的条件中。
最新评论
本站CDN与莫名CDN同款、亚太CDN、速度还不错,值得推荐。
感谢推荐我们公司产品、有什么活动会第一时间公布!
我在用这类站群服务器、还可以. 用很多年了。